What Are the Key Features of the Best Quality Inversion Table?

The key features of the best quality inversion table include:

  • Sturdy Construction: The best quality inversion tables are built with high-grade materials, such as steel frames, ensuring durability and stability during use.
  • Adjustable Height Settings: These tables often come with customizable height adjustments to accommodate users of different heights, providing a comfortable and safe inversion experience.
  • Safety Features: Quality inversion tables typically include safety straps, ankle supports, and a locking mechanism to securely hold the user in place while inverted.
  • Comfortable Padding: The best models feature thick, cushioned padding on the backrest and ankle supports, enhancing comfort during inversion and allowing for longer use without discomfort.
  • Ease of Use: High-quality inversion tables are designed for user-friendly operation, often with clear instructions and intuitive mechanisms for easy setup and inversion.
  • Portability: Some of the best inversion tables can be easily folded and stored, making them convenient for users with limited space.
  • Weight Capacity: Quality inversion tables have a higher weight capacity, which increases their versatility and allows a broader range of users to safely use the equipment.
  • Warranty: Reputable brands often provide a substantial warranty, reflecting their confidence in the durability and longevity of their inversion tables.

Sturdy construction is essential as it guarantees that the inversion table can withstand the weight and movements of the user without wobbling or collapsing. Adjustable height settings cater to individual user needs, allowing everyone to find the right position for effective inversion therapy.

Safety features like ankle supports and locking mechanisms are critical to preventing accidents, ensuring users can focus on relaxation rather than worry about their stability. Comfortable padding on the backrest and ankle supports is important for user comfort, allowing for longer sessions without discomfort or pain.

Ease of use is a hallmark of high-quality inversion tables, as they should allow users to quickly set up and adjust the table without complex processes. Portability features help users who may want to store the table away when not in use, making it a practical choice for home environments.

A higher weight capacity is a significant consideration, as it ensures that the table can support a wider range of body types safely. Finally, a good warranty from the manufacturer indicates a commitment to quality and customer satisfaction, reassuring the user of the product’s reliability.

How Do Safety Features Affect Your Choice of an Inversion Table?

When choosing the best quality inversion table, safety features play a crucial role in ensuring user confidence and preventing accidents.

  • Safety Straps: Safety straps are essential for securing the user in place while inverting. They help prevent accidental falls by providing a reliable means of attachment that keeps the user anchored to the table.
  • Locking Mechanisms: A robust locking mechanism ensures that the inversion table remains in the desired position during use. This feature prevents unexpected movements that could lead to injury, making it vital for users who may be new to inversion therapy.
  • Non-Slip Footrests: Non-slip footrests provide stability and grip for the user’s feet while inverting. This feature is particularly important for maintaining balance and preventing slippage, which can cause accidents during inversion.
  • Adjustable Height Settings: Adjustable height settings accommodate users of different sizes and body types, promoting a safer and more personalized experience. Proper adjustment ensures that the user can securely position themselves without straining or risking injury.
  • Padding and Support: Adequate padding and support on the inversion table enhance comfort and safety. Thick padding helps to cushion the user’s back and legs, reducing the risk of discomfort or injury during prolonged use.
  • Sturdy Frame Construction: A sturdy frame construction is crucial for overall stability and durability of the inversion table. High-quality materials can support greater weight and withstand the dynamic forces experienced during inversion, contributing to user safety.
  • Safety Warning Labels: Clear safety warning labels guide users on how to use the inversion table properly. These labels often include important information about weight limits and usage instructions, helping to prevent misuse that could lead to injury.

What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ing an Inversion Table?

When choosing the best quality inversion table, several key factors should be considered to ensure effectiveness and safety.

  • Weight Capacity: Look for an inversion table that can comfortably support your weight, typically ranging from 200 to 600 pounds. A higher weight capacity generally indicates a sturdier construction, which increases safety and durability during use.
  • Adjustability: An ideal inversion table should offer adjustable settings for height and inversion angles. This feature allows users of different sizes to customize the table for their specific needs, ensuring proper alignment and comfort while inverting.
  • Safety Features: Consider tables with safety straps, ankle supports, and a stable frame design. These features are crucial for preventing accidents and ensuring that the user remains secure during the inversion process.
  • Build Quality: The materials used in the construction of the inversion table are important for durability. Look for high-quality steel frames and robust padding, as these components contribute to the overall longevity and performance of the table.
  • Portability: If space is a concern, choosing a foldable inversion table can be beneficial. A portable design allows for easy storage and transport, making it convenient for users who may want to move the table between locations or store it when not in use.
  • Comfort: The padding and overall design should provide sufficient comfort during use. Opt for tables with contoured or cushioned surfaces to reduce pressure points and enhance the user experience while inverting.
  • Brand Reputation and Warranty: Consider products from reputable brands that offer warranties. A strong warranty indicates confidence in the product’s quality and provides peace of mind regarding potential defects or issues.
